Looking for some new Android wallpapers? Here's the Android Authority Wallpaper Wednesday roundup for February 19, 2025.
Six University of Texas at Austin faculty members were announced today as recipients of Sloan Research Fellowships from the Alfred P. Sloan Foundation, putting UT Austin at the forefront among public 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results